Madison Limestone/Amsden Formation The Madison Limestone is over 700 feet thick and has a dominating influence on the landscape of the Bighorn Basin and the surrounding mountains because of its high resistance to erosion. Less obvious is the dissolving of the Madison Limestone to form numerous caves throughout the region as well. The Madison Limestone formed during the Mississippian Period about 350 million years ago. Some caves formed in this limestone way back then. One might wonder how does one date a hole in the rock.

Stress Fractures, Joints, And you will Cavern Passageways Most of the caves are of a much younger origin. When the region was uplifted it put a lot of strain on the rocks and that resulted in stress fractures called joints. These typically form in two primary directions (which depend on the direction from which the uplifting force is coming) and these can be seen as cracks running in those two directions on the surface of the rock.

Seeing Bighorn Cave Caving parties must have 3 to 6 people and contain at least one person familiar with the cave. Only two parties are allowed in the cave at any one time. The entrance is protected by a cage which also protects the cavers’ ropes that are necessary to negotiate the 70-80 foot cave entrance. So far fourteen miles of passageway are known making it the longest cave in Montana.

Most other Caves At the Bighorn Canyon Bighorn Canyon National Recreation Area is usually not thought of as a cave park in the National Park system, and most visitors only see the big holes about 75 feet down from the top of the Madison Limestone as they look into the canyon or go up and down the lake. Many of those holes however extend back into the canyon walls and are indeed caves.
